Going for plastic surgery is almost like getting a tattoo done. You get addicted and one is never enough. You have your breasts enlarged and suddenly you 'see' this bump on your nose or the thin lips or the love-handles. You'll start looking for flaws just so you can go back under the knife. I know. It's an addiction problem combined with a low self-esteem and it becomes an ugly obsession. But then my question is this: why can't surgeons say no or is it really all about the money? Do surgeons ever come to a point where they refuse to operate on a patient? Perhaps only once the person no longer looks like a human being? They are giving the plastic surgery industry a bad name.

Point is, the damage is done and there's nothing they can do to fix it, so they, once again, turn to plastic surgery. It's a vicious cycle. Don't get me wrong, I'm completely pro-plastic surgery, because it has changed the lives of many people for the better, but theres a fine line not to be overstepped.
